Good Points

Light Weight, Very accurate, Good value for money, Saftey catch


Bad Points

Only available in .22, Basic wood finish


General Comments

I had been looking to make the move to a precharge air rifle for quite some time. I wanted the advantage of a bolt action rifle, and liked the fact that they where light weight. After a good look I finally settled on the AGS PCR 1. My first impressions of the rifle where good, it's light weight, compact design ment that it was good in the field and its basic but robust stock meant that it could take the rigors of hunting. After a full charge of gas I managed to sight it in about 15 mines and was getting groups about the size of a 10p at 35 yards. On its first trip out I bagged a bunny. I hit the rabbit with a clean headshot at around 25 yards and the Coney dropped straight away. Due to the weather I have not been able to shoot since, but I will be going ratting soon, so I'll be sure to update this review with more results. My opinion of this rifle so far is very good indeed.
